私信我吧,或者给我百度hi发消息。
追答私信已发
追问没收到,,,
追答我发了的是“私信”。
我现在再用“发送消息”、“ 离线留言”各发了一遍
下面转发一段没写完的教材(百度限制篇幅,只能发个开头):
输入法编程入门教程
我是一个输入法编程的爱好者,在学习过程中,痛感现在输入法编程的资料太少,质量太差
,在经历了艰难曲折的过程之后,我才对输入法编程略知一二。在此我想编写一个浅显易懂
的输入法编程入门教程,愿意与大家分享我的经验。但由于我也是初学者,水平不高,所讲
的内容肯定有错误,敬请高手达人指出。
本教程起点较低,只需要两部分基础知识:一是C语言基础。二是SDK Windows程序设计基
础。所谓SDK方式指的是直接调用Windows的API函数进行程序设计的方式,我们用的是面
向过程的C语言,而非面向对象的C++语言,有些网友学习的MFC程序设计,那是面向对
象的程序设计方式。编程法程序一般来讲比较底层,不需要用面向对象的方式。如果没有S
DKWindows程序设计基础,如何学习?本人推荐一本非常有名的著作《Windows程序设计》
,网上有电子版下载,书店也有实物书销售。最新版的价格为100多元。
本教程分几课进行,今天讲的是第一课:
第一部分 制作输入法空壳
什么是输入法程序?输入法程序是一种动态链接库文件,动态链接库文件不是独立的应用程
序,它是供应用程序使用的,扩展名绝大部分为.dll,也有别的扩展名比如.ime,或.fnt等
等,我们的输入法程序扩展名就为.ime。动态链接库文件自己是无法执行的,它只能……
对
追答是想编写类似于搜狗等输入法程序吗?
追问是的,但是只需要把接口都做好能安装就行,输入的逻辑可以不需要
怎样用VC++语言实现打开输入法?(Windows系统)
到此,我们已经了解了Windows系统控制输入法的原理知识,下面我们开始着手创建一个控制输入法的C++类,主要步骤如下:1. 创建一个新类,新类名为:CInputLanguage 2. 新建一个保存输入法信息的结构。当加载系统已安装的输入法信息时,用一个此结构的链表来保存输入法信息。struct IL{ char ilID[15]...
怎样电脑编程序
准备材料windows电脑、VC++(DEV_C++)1.打开桌面上的DEV_C++,进入如下界面:2.快捷键“CTRL+N”建立新源代码。3.输入源代码,下面给出最简单的Hello,world源代码:#include <stdio.h>int main( ){printf("Hello,Worldn");return 0;}4.按下F11编译并且运行源代码,得到运行结果:5.点击任意键返回源代码编辑界面...
在vc++6.0编写程序中用的是什么输入法?
首先程序中写的代码必须是英文,如果你用的是搜狗输入法,只要按下shift键把中文切换成英文,然后如果你写的是字符串,那么字符串里面可以输入中文或者英文,希望对你有帮助,我是用搜狗输入法,因为英文中午可以随时切换,可以很好的备注代码。符号是从键盘是通过shift键组合起来,输入到电脑里面的。
输入法的自动关联功能是怎么实现的?用什么做》?
输入法也是程序,程序就是用程序设计语言编写的。想现在Windows操作系统下主流的应用软件开发语言当属VC++。对搜狗输入法进行查壳处理,发现时Microsoft Visual Studio .NET 2005 -- 2008 -> Microsoft Corporation [Overlay] *。更准确的说,应当属于VS.NET里面的VC++。---你输入字会出现提示,为何?...
怎么写VC++程序检查系统补丁是否安装完整
系统目录: C:\\WINDOWS\\system32 启动设备: \\Device\\HarddiskVolume1 系统区域设置: zh-cn;中文(中国)输入法区域设置: zh-cn;中文(中国)时区: 暂缺 物理内存总量: 2,047 MB 可用的物理内存: 1,371 MB 虚拟内存: 最大值: 2,048 MB 虚拟内存: 可用: 1,992 MB 虚拟...
我用VC++6.0写的东西复制出来汉字就变成了乱码 , 而且从其他地方复制...
1、删除English(United States)键盘布局,将默认输入法设为中文输入法下的任意一个。2、在VC窗口中开始复制之前,将输入法切换为一种中文输入法,然后进行复制;在word中粘贴时,输入法可以为任意一种。另外还有就是在vc++6.0中打汉字的时候,打出来的汉字突然变成乱码,但从开始打上的汉字没问题,复制刚才打的也没问题...
VC++在编程时候不支持中文输入怎么办
若需在变量名中使用中文,一种解决方法是将中文变量名转换为英文或拼音。例如,将"用户ID"转换为"userID"或"userInfo"。这样能够确保在VC++环境中无问题地使用变量名。同时,这也符合编程中使用英文的习惯,便于代码的阅读和维护。对于将中文作为函数参数的情况,通常不会遇到直接的输入问题。VC++能够...
C\/C++程序设计学习与实验系统的特色功能
作业题实验题都在VC6.0下调试通过,如图11所示,只要打开相应章节然后在单击图11中“选择题号”右边的向下的箭头即可选择题号即可直接用软件打开调试通过的源程序进行编辑、运行。四、对照练习功能可以很方便地练习教程中的所有程序、互联网上的程序、自己电脑上的程序。1 单击图11中的“...
求个win7 64位操作系统的VC++ 6.0
楼上说的是操作系统吧!但显然人家要的只是一个开发工具.VC++6.0是很早之前的一个开发工具,你指的现在的其实还是原来的那个xp时代常用的vc6.0.我原来下过一个,直接在win7 64位上安装使用过一段时间.你用百度一下就能找到的.只是VC6在win7上可能有时会有点不正常的反应....
...哪些?大公司的软件一般是用什么编的(如QQ 金山毒霸 搜狗输入法...
C\\C++ 常用软件是MS VC++(6.0和更高版本)集成在微软的开发工具visual studio中,JAVA桌面编程常用软件是netbean,网络编程是MyEclipse(包括了常用的Eclipse和常用工具,目前Java最流行的网络编程软件)。C#没有别的软件,就是MS VC#,也集成在了Visual studio中,常用的是2005版,还有2008,微软官方有...